Purple Maui (Happy Harvest)
Purple Maui Medical Marijuana Strain Review
From: Happy Harvest
Type: Sativa-dominant hybrid
Price: $50/8th
Grade: B+
Appearance: (8/10) Very nice fall colors associated with Maui, beautiful purple traits throughout the plant, and great trichome count and structure.
Aroma: (6/10) Nice scent but not that strong, the familiar Maui, soft pine hints.
Taste: (4/10) This sample was hashy and fairly harsh for Maui. A little tongue numbing upon exhale.
Effects: This is a fast acting medicine, making itself felt directly in the jaws and cheek bone areas of the face. Heart rate quickly jumped along with a very cerebral rush of energy. I found myself with sweaty palms and often repeating my last few words or sentences. Indica traits were felt in the neck and shoulder region via muscle relaxation.
Duration: Long. 2.5 + hours
Medicinal Use: (We are NOT doctors – peronal opinion ONLY) Sativa traits good for mood elevation, behavioral issues, mild pain relief, and head focused issues. Some mild muscle based problems – not a strong muscle relaxer.
Overall: The Purple Maui looked great and had very solid potency for the strain, maybe an A- strength to it. However, the after medicating effects were intense and I was extremely drained and tired, barely able to function with a list of chores to accomplish. We feel like a strain should provide the indica pain relief and relazing qualities if it leaves us with an indica like comatose situation after medicating. Other folks may find this to be a good hybrid choice, with this one leaning more towards the middle than most Maui (sativa) samples we’ve reviewed.
